If you are considering improving your teeth’s appearance, you are not alone. Many people have been conscious of their teeth that they have resorted to ways such as dental bleaching and bonding. However, not all dental problems can be addressed by bleaching and bonding. This is where dental veneer comes in handy.
A discolored tooth may be applied with whitening products but if the discoloration is intrinsic and the tooth has damaged pulp, the treatment will be hardly effective. Intrinsic discoloration can be addressed not by removing the stain, but covering the entire tooth through veneers. It is a more developed version of composite bonding designed to bond with the tooth for cosmetic improvement.
Also known as dental laminates, veneers are made with porcelain wafer-thin shells placed on the front side of the teeth. Although porcelain is brittle, it becomes strong and durable when bonded to a sturdy structure. There are at least three advantages of porcelain veneers, namely natural appearance, stain resistance, and short procedure duration.
Dental veneers are usually preferred over other types of composite bonding because of the translucence of the porcelain shell used. Before, composite bonding is the only treatment that uses semi-translucent material. Porcelain veneers nowadays are made to mimic the way tooth enamel handles light, which accounts for their lustrous appearance. Composite bonding and dental implants Lexington dentists may offer are susceptible to stains. Veneers, however, are not. This is because veneers are made with glass-like material just like porcelain cups that do not turn yellow even after being filled over and over with coffee or tea. Though veneers are not entirely stain-proof, it can remain stain-free for years through proper care.
Lastly, dental veneers are easier to install and require only a little preparation. A dentist can place them on a patient’s teeth in at least two separate appointments, each lasting for about 90 minutes. The dentist has to remove some enamel from a patient’s teeth before placing the porcelain shells. The procedure is mostly painless since it involves the use of local anesthesia during the removal of tooth enamel. It requires no recovery period.
